Drop the assumption that common sense and unconventionality can't get along. People predict parallel lines for Virgo, who follows the manual, and Aquarius, who keeps rewriting it — a lazy prediction. These two signs share an engine nobody talks about: analysis. Virgo analyzes what's in front of them; Aquarius analyzes what doesn't exist yet. Same root, different branch — get this pairing right and the conversation runs long. The target differs, but the way you each think is nearly identical.

If you're dating, the first hurdle comes when Virgo's real-world care reads to Aquarius as interference. Turn half that care into questions instead, and the hurdle passes. At work or in business, the moment Virgo starts verifying Aquarius's experiments, you beat both the all-ideas-no-execution team and the all-execution-no-ideas team. On money, Virgo not trying to fully understand Aquarius's spending on the unfamiliar is itself the condition for peace. But if you each start trying to correct the other by your own standard, the story changes. Virgo's standards and Aquarius's freedom both turn into weapons the moment they're used to fix a partner. Putting the weapon down costs nothing.

One long-running psychological finding maps onto this pairing exactly: cognitive diversity — teams where two people solve problems differently outperform teams of similar thinkers. One condition attaches: classify each other's approach as different, not wrong. Difference classified as different becomes a resource; difference classified as wrong becomes a front line. It's the same old truth that compatibility isn't inherited — it's built by how you treat each other. 66 is a score for raw materials. Cooking is up to the two of you.

This week, pick one habit of your partner's that makes no sense to you and just observe it for a week, without a single correction. Every time the urge to fix it rises, write it down instead. After a week, ask why they do it. A question, not a correction. Curiosity beats nagging. A week of observation is short; ten years of correcting is long. When did you last get curious about your partner? That one week of turning correction into observation is what tears the ceiling off this 66.
